LOYALTY is the fourth book in L.P. Maxa's RiffRaff
Records series. As with the previous books in
this series, L.P. Maxa explores the highs and lows of a
rock and roll celebrity family. The Devil's Share
extended family is a hodgepodge of quirky characters with
high sex drives. There might be a lot of lies told by the
younger set in this family, but there is also a lot of
genuine affection and loyalty. In LOYALTY, Katie Cadence
and Cash Matthews meet and it's love at first sight.
Because her parents passed away suddenly, before ever
getting a chance to know them, Katie Cadence's brother
has been the father figure in her life. A loving, yet
overly protective, father which has left Katie a little
sheltered. The Devil's Share brood are far from sheltered
and indulge in quite a few things that are new to Katie.
When Katie is shuffled off to The Devil's Share compound,
her mind is blown, and she experiences a freedom she's
never known. The last thing she expected was to find
romance. Luckily for Katie, she's safe with Cash as she
learns to let go. Cash proves to be more caring boyfriend
than teenage horn dog. Things quickly get super steamy
between Cash and Katie, but L.P. Maxa does a good job of
providing an age appropriate perspective for the young
lovers. Although their parents are rock royalty, this
hero and heroine are not jaded and cynical when it comes
to love. The love story between Cash and Katie provides
LOYALTY with plenty of charm. The conflict surrounding
Cash's twin brother Crue and his shenanigans provides
plenty of drama. Crue's behavior in LOYALTY provides an
interesting contrast to Cash and help define Cash's
character.
LOYALTY is a compelling story about family and a love
story that's a little bit sweet and spicy. This is my
favorite story, so far, in L.P. Maxa's RiffRaff
Records series. I can't wait for Crue to grow up and
gain some
sense by the time his story rolls around. I look forward
to L.P. Maxa's next romance novel.
Twins Cash and Crue Matthews are as close as brothers can
be. Cash would do anything for Crue, so much so he lived
a lie - a huge lie - for over a year. Cash doesn't know
who he's angrier with, himself for doing it, or Crue for
asking. Either way, Cash feels like crap. Then, Mason
Maxwell's sweeter than sin daughter, Katie Cadence, drops
into his life and Cash has a new purpose. But...how will
she react to his secret, and can he risk losing her by
telling the truth?
Katie Cadence's parents have treated her like she'd
evaporate in the rain. True, her beginning was so tragic
the news media covered it for years. But, damn. She wants
to break free and take chances. When she's banished to
the Devil's Share compound, she expects more of the same,
only to find the Devil's Spawn know how to live, and
Katie is all in for spreading her wings. Who's offered to
give her the guided tour: Cash Matthews. Falling in love
isn't on her list of firsts, but when it hits she has no
choice but to go with it.
